Amos 7:1-9 - Warning Visions

1 The Lord God showed me this: He was forming a swarm of locusts at the time the spring crop first began to sprout—after the cutting of the king’s hay. 2 When the locusts finished eating the vegetation of the land, I said, “Lord God, please forgive! How will Jacob survive since he is so small?”

3 The Lord relented concerning this. “It will not happen,” He said.

4 The Lord God showed me this: The Lord God was calling for a judgment by fire. It consumed the great deep and devoured the land. 5 Then I said, “Lord God, please stop! How will Jacob survive since he is so small?”

6 The Lord relented concerning this. “This will not happen either,” said the Lord God.

7 He showed me this: The Lord was standing there by a vertical wall with a plumb line in His hand. 8 The Lord asked me, “What do you see, Amos?”

I replied, “A plumb line.”

Then the Lord said, “I am setting a plumb line among My people Israel; I will no longer spare them:

9 Isaac’s high places will be deserted,
and Israel’s sanctuaries will be in ruins;
I will rise up against the house of Jeroboam
with a sword.”
